Russell Belk

Russell Belk is a renowned scholar in marketing and consumer behavior, well known for his work on how people view possessions and material goods. He explores how possessions shape identity, social relationships, and emotions, emphasizing that items are more than just objects—they hold meaning and significance. His research helps us understand why people buy, keep, or value certain things, revealing the psychological and cultural roles of materialism in everyday life. Overall, Belk's work sheds light on the deep connection between consumers and their possessions, highlighting how consumption influences personal and social identity.
